"Reduce, reuse, recycle" could be the motto of this quirky cocktail lounge and salvaged-art gallery, from the owners of the Back Room. The artsy bar is decked out in interactive works fashioned from found objects, such as a car-hood DJ booth, bike-chain chandeliers and a bar made from compressed shredded money snagged (legally) from the Minnesota Reserve. Settle into one of the bathtub or coffin couches and order from a small selection of drinks that includes wine, beers (Goose Island IPA, Coney Island Lager, O'Hara's Stout) and creative cocktails, like the Silk Thai (vodka, tawny port, thai basil, velvet falernum, lemon juice and egg whites).
